Transaction 2c11977de620e084754a7de44a323e15825abb4d50807b771354edd856eeda56
1 Input
1 Output
-
2c11977de620e084754a7de44a323e15825abb4d50807b771354edd856eeda56:0
- value
- 1026626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 813bcf0753004e3a3b55a6ff448c9c8649c01440 OP_EQUAL
- address
- 3DULjsWH7mszJX6a1Hm4Z7KWYnXbXefPZU